The accuracy and precision of a result depend on several factors, including:
1. Quality of the measurement tools - Using high-quality measurement instruments can lead to more accurate and precise results.
2. Calibration of instruments - Instruments should be calibrated regularly to ensure accurate and precise readings.
3. Skill of the person performing the measurement - The person performing the measurements must have proper training and knowledge of the tool they're using.
4. Sample size - Increasing the sample size can lead to more accurate results.
5. Sampling bias - If the sample used for the measurement is biased, it can lead to inaccurate or imprecise results.
6. Experimental design - Proper experimental design can help reduce measurement errors and increase accuracy.
